  One such great man, in the Semitic belt of earth was Hd. Ibraheem( a.s) – the great patriarch. His fore fathers probably came to Mesopotamia from Armenia   and challenged the Amorites- then ruling there; who belonged to the early settled- Semitic- branch. The Mesopotamian Empire had been established around 2300 BC and to this part belonged the world’s Ist urban civilization, wherein the great ruler, Namrood   ruled, and the great architectural marvels in the shape of imposing ziggurat temples existed when Hd Ibraheem and his father Aazer appear on the scene.
    Surah No 19, 21 and 37 tell us about the statue breaking episode and the wrath of  Namrood; that ultimately forced Hd. Ibrahim ( a.s) to leave the place…wander from here and there, to Syria, Egypt, ,Hebron, Palestine etc. On the death of his Ist wife-Hd. Sarah,   he buried her at Hebron. In 1927 AD the great archeologist- Mader, found the sepulcher of both.
   But prior to that Hd Ibraheem left his son- Hd  Ismail, and 2nd wife Hajira nearer to a dilapidated structure in Arab land, called  baitul ateeq, that was latter built and used  as house of worship , called Kabaa- the cuboid, or Bait ullah. During the annual pilgrimage time, Muslims circumambulate, make its 7 rounds i.e tawaf, keeping left arm towards it.

  Masjid- e- Harrum in its present vastly expanded form of today that encloses Kaaba , has 112 entrance points called ‘ Babs’ and a number of escalators- easily remembered by their numerical number than the name given to each. Expansion projects undertaken at different times, has subsumed many dwelling places and areas  of yore associated with prophet’s life period and placing conjecturally those of historical value is a difficult exercise now, for visitors having limited time. Mention of the houses of Hd. Khadija, Um Hanni, Hd. Zubayr & Arqam surfaced in my thoughts while I was in Makkah but in Medina it turned to pain when the empty 4th place, and the burial place of ‘The man who enlightened the world’ was found dark, unlit, though buildings outside on all sides were well lit.
   Since arrogant shurta and police men  abound Masjid-e- Harrum area, any attempt to  make a study would have landed me in trouble, I satiated my curiosity by guesstimating that Holy Kaaba is still a cuboid ( though Hateem/ Hujr-e-Ismael side had to shortened due to availability of short sized planks, when during prophets life time Kaaba had to be reconstructed—thereafter scholars say it was reconstructed a score times). 14 meters high, its sides vary from 11 to 12 ½ meters, with (the only visible) door 7 ½ feet above ground (probably to be safe from flooding waters  ..in 1941 Kaaba was reportedly submerged upto 5 feet…but now drainage system doesn’t allow such things to happen now).  Books do speak of a rear door called mustajaar, now closed; only mortar pointing reveals it. Above the Hateem- side 1 meter long roof pipe ( parnala) made of gold, called al-Mezaab can be seen .
